#DCF9DC Hex Color Code

#DCF9DC

The Hexadecimal Color #DCF9DC is a contrast shade of Beige. #DCF9DC RGB value is rgb(220, 249, 220). RGB Color Model of #DCF9DC consists of 86% red, 97% green and 86% blue. HSL color Mode of #DCF9DC has 120°(degrees) Hue, 71% Saturation and 92% Lightness. #DCF9DC color has an wavelength of 544.44444n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#DCF9DC is #FFFF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#DCF9DC is #DFD. The Closest Color to #DCF9DC is #F5F5DC. Official Name of #DCF9DC Hex Code is Snowy Mint.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#DCF9DC is 12 Cyan 0 Magenta 12 Yellow 2 Black and #DCF9DC CMY is 12, 0, 12.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#DCF9DC is hsl(120,71,92,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(120, 12, 98).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#DCF9DC is 76.31, 88.13, 80.69.
Hex8 Value of #DCF9DC is #DCF9DCFF. Decimal Value of #DCF9DC is 14481884 and Octal Value of #DCF9DC is 67174734. Binary Value of #DCF9DC is 11011100, 11111001, 11011100 and Android of #DCF9DC is 4292671964 / 0xffdcf9dc.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#DCF9DC is 0.311, 0.36, 0.36 and YIQ Color Space of #DCF9DC is 237.023, -7.9634, -15.1583.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#DCF9DC is 80.68, 96.4, 80.78.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#DCF9DC is 95.22, -14.67, 10.76.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#DCF9DC is 95.22, -14.55, 18.8.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#DCF9DC is 95.22, 18.19, 143.74. Hunter Lab variable of #DCF9DC is 93.88, -19.19, 14.75.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#DCF9DC

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
